Tamil Nadu Launches T3 Mission to Expand Technical Textile Manufacturing

Tamil Nadu has introduced the Tamil Nadu Technical Textiles Mission (T3 Mission) as part of the State Budget 2025–26 to strengthen its presence in high-value textile manufacturing. The initiative, with an allocation of ₹15 crore, is aimed at supporting technical textile production and attracting new investments. It is being implemented by the Department of Textiles, Government of Tamil Nadu.

The Government of Tamil Nadu has initiated the Tamil Nadu Technical Textiles Mission (T3 Mission) to support the growth of technical textiles in the state. Announced in the State Budget 2025–26, the programme has an outlay of ₹15 crore and is being executed by the Department of Textiles.

The mission is designed as an industry-focused programme supported by a dedicated Project Management Team (PMT) at the Directorate of Textiles. The PMT is assisted by a group of national and international technical consultants, providing structured support across the project lifecycle, from initial planning to commissioning. The initiative is open to both new and existing textile units seeking to diversify into technical textiles.

During the initial phase, the Department conducted outreach sessions across major textile clusters, including Tirupur, Karur, Madurai, and Salem. These sessions aimed to increase awareness and engagement with industry stakeholders. Several participants have begun exploring opportunities in technical textiles with guidance from empanelled consultants.

In the second phase, the mission introduces financial assistance for eligible units. The scheme provides support covering 50% of the end-to-end technical support fee, with a maximum limit of ₹50 lakh per unit. The disbursement is structured in stages based on project milestones.

The Department of Textiles is also organising a Government-cum-Industry delegation to Techtextil Frankfurt 2026, scheduled from April 21–24, 2026, in Frankfurt, Germany. Around 10 entrepreneurs are expected to participate in the visit, which will provide exposure to international technologies, product developments, and market trends, along with opportunities for interaction with global manufacturers.

In addition, the mission is encouraging international collaborations, including joint venture opportunities with companies from Taiwan in segments such as activewear, athleisure, nonwovens, and footwear.

The T3 Mission is part of broader efforts to support innovation, facilitate investments, and expand export capabilities within Tamil Nadu’s textile sector, with a focus on technical textiles.
